A brilliant opportunity to join a fast-growing, culture-driven PBSA operator as their next Sales Executive. If you love speaking to people, converting enquiries, and delivering standout customer service, this role will suit you perfectly. You'll be part of a central sales team handling inbound enquiries across phone, email, live chat and social channels - guiding students through their booking journey and helping the portfolio hit occupancy and revenue targets. Think of it as a mix of leasing, reservations, and customer experience, all within a brand that genuinely cares about its residents. This is a 12-month FTC, but for the right person there's real potential to stay on and even grow into a bigger role.

How to prepare for a job interview at The People Pod
✨Know Your Numbers
In sales and business development, being numbers-savvy is crucial. Brush up on key metrics like conversion rates and sales growth percentages that are relevant to the role at The People Pod. It’s all about showing you can analyse data to drive better decisions.
✨Be Prepared for Role-Play Scenarios
Expect role-play scenarios where you're asked to sell a product or handle objections. It’s a great chance to showcase your communication skills and your approach to overcoming challenges. Practice these with a friend or in front of the mirror – it can really help you feel at ease during the interview!
